Cowboys receiver Patrick Crayton is happy his new contract extension is done and he said he had no desire to test free agency. But he possibly could have received a bigger contract than his four-year, $14 million deal that included a $6 million signing bonus if he had tried.
``I wasn't trying to break the bank,'' Crayton said. ``I'm not a greedy person. I'm happy now. I am set financially the way I need to be.''
Crayton also wanted his mind clear for the playoffs and didn't want to think about relocating his family to another city.
``I didn't want to be dealing it with especially during the playoffs,'' Crayton said. ``Now I am back to my comfort level.''
